Template Types

Simple Invoice Template

Best for: Small jobs, one-off work, straightforward invoicing

Includes:

  • Basic business and customer information
  • Simple line items
  • Payment terms
  • Payment details

Detailed Invoice Template

Best for: Larger jobs, complex work, multiple line items

Includes:

  • All basic information
  • Detailed breakdown of work
  • Material costs
  • Labour costs
  • Tax breakdown (if VAT registered)
  • Terms and conditions

Professional Invoice Template

Best for: Established businesses, regular customers, B2B work

Includes:

  • Branded header with logo space
  • Detailed breakdown
  • Payment terms and late payment policy
  • Company registration details
  • VAT information (if applicable)

Detailed Invoice Template

═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════
INVOICE
═══════════════════════════════════════════════════════

Invoice Number: INV-2024-001
Date Issued: 15 January 2024
Due Date: 29 January 2024 (14 days)

FROM:
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
[Your Business Name]
[Your Business Address]
[City, Postcode]
Phone: [Your Phone]
Email: [Your Email]
[Website if applicable]

TO:
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
[Customer Name]
[Customer Address]
[City, Postcode]

DESCRIPTION OF WORK:
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
[Detailed description of work completed]

ITEMISED BREAKDOWN:
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
Item Quantity Rate Amount
─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
Labour - Installation 8 hours £45.00 £360.00
Labour - Testing 2 hours £45.00 £90.00
Materials - Copper pipes 15m £10.00 £150.00
Materials - Fittings Various - £85.00
Parts - Boiler components 1 set - £120.00
─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
───────
SUBTOTAL: £805.00
VAT (20% - if applicable): £161.00
───────
TOTAL: £966.00
═══════

PAYMENT TERMS:
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
Payment due within 14 days of invoice date.
Late payment may incur charges in accordance with the Late Payment of Commercial Debts (Interest) Act 1998.

PAYMENT METHODS:
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
Bank Transfer (preferred):
Bank: [Your Bank Name]
Account Name: [Your Business Name]
Sort Code: [XX-XX-XX]
Account Number: [XXXXXXXX]
Reference: INV-2024-001

Cheque:
Please make cheques payable to [Your Business Name]

Thank you for your business!

Questions? Contact us at [Your Email] or [Your Phone]

Using Spreadsheet Templates

Benefits:

  • Automatic calculations
  • Easy to track
  • Can generate invoices from data

Setup:

  1. Create columns: Invoice Number, Date, Customer, Description, Amount, Status
  2. Add formulas for totals
  3. Create invoice template sheet
  4. Use VLOOKUP to populate invoice from data

Using Invoice Software

Recommended tools:

  • Invoice2go - Simple, mobile-friendly (£5-15/month)
  • QuickBooks - Full accounting + invoicing (£12-25/month)
  • Xero - Professional invoicing (£10-30/month)
  • Zoho Invoice - Free tier available

Invoice Template Checklist

Before Creating Your Template

  • Choose template style (simple, detailed, or professional)
  • Gather all your business information
  • Decide on invoice numbering system
  • Set payment terms
  • Get bank account details ready
  • Decide on payment methods

Template Must Include

  • Invoice number
  • Date issued
  • Due date
  • Your business name
  • Your business address
  • Your contact information
  • Customer name
  • Customer address
  • Description of work
  • Line items with prices
  • Subtotal
  • Total amount
  • Payment terms
  • Payment details (bank account, etc.)
  • Payment reference
  • Logo/branding
  • VAT number (if registered)
  • Company registration number
  • Terms and conditions
  • Late payment policy
  • Website/social media links
